html{
width:100%;
height:100%;
}

body{
background-color:#FFB96D;
background-image:url(../images/bg3.gif);
padding:0;
margin:0;
}

.hr90{background-color:#FFFFFF; color:#FFFFFF; height:1px; width:90%; border:none;}
.hr100{background-color:#FFFFFF; color:#FFFFFF; height:1px; width:100%; border:none;}

#header_links {
  margin-top: 0px;
  margin-bottom: 0px;  
  font-size: 10px;
  color: #CC6600;
  font-style: normal;
  font-weight: normal;
  font-family: Verdana, Helvetica, sans-serif;
}

#header_links a {
  margin-top: 0px;
  margin-bottom: 0px;  
  font-size: 10px;
  color: #CC6600;
  font-style: normal;
  font-weight: normal;
  font-family: Verdana, Helvetica, sans-serif;
}

.customer_billing_nav {
  background-image:url(../images/customer_billing_nav_bg.gif);
  background-color: #EFB652;
  background-repeat: no-repeat;
}

a.white_links {
  color: #FFFFFF;
}
#white_links a {
  color: #FFFFFF;
	text-decoration: underline;
}
	

.left_navigation {
  background-image:url(../images/bg_left.gif);
  background-color: #F9B77D;
}

.main_body {
  background-image:url(../images/bg_right.gif);
  background-color: #F5D4B1;
}

.full_table_bg {
  background-image:url(../images/full_bg.gif);
  background-color: #F5D4B1;
}

.portfolio_client_header {
  background-color: #FFA037;
	color: #FFFFFF;
	font-size: 13px;
  font-style: normal;
  font-weight: normal;
  font-family: Verdana, Helvetica, sans-serif;
	
}

.portfolio_table {
  background-color: #FFD9C6;
  border:#ffffff 1px solid;
}

.account_access_table {
  background-color: #F5D4B1;
	border-style: solid;
	border-width: 1px;
	border-color: #FFFFFF;
}


  
.contact_nav {
  color: #993300; 

}

.contact_nav_header {

  font-size: 13px;
  font-style: normal;
  font-weight: bold;
  color: #FFFFFF;
  font-family: Verdana, Helvetica, sans-serif;
}


td, p {
  font-size: 13px;
  color: #CC6600;
  font-style: normal;
  font-weight: normal;
  font-family: Verdana, Helvetica, sans-serif;
}

h2 {
  font-size: 14px;
  color: #CC6600;
  font-style: normal;
  font-weight: bold;
  font-family: Verdana, Helvetica, sans-serif;

}


h3 {
  font-size: 14px;
  color: #CC6600;
  font-style: normal;
  font-weight: bold;
  font-family: Verdana, Helvetica, sans-serif;

}

.news_item {
  color: #336633;
	font-size:13px;
	font-style: normal;
  font-family: Verdana, Helvetica, sans-serif;
}

h4 {

  font-size: 14px;
  color: #FFFFFF;
  font-style: normal;
  font-weight: bold;
  font-family: Verdana, Helvetica, sans-serif;

}
h1 {
text-align:left;
padding-left:5px;
  margin-top: 0px;
  margin-bottom: 0px;  
  font-size: 10px;
  color: #CC6600;
  font-style: normal;
  font-weight: normal;
  font-family: Verdana, Helvetica, sans-serif;

}
h5 {
  margin-top: 4px;
  margin-bottom: 4px;
  font-size: 13px;
  color: #CC6600;
  font-style: normal;
  font-weight: bold;
  font-family: Verdana, Helvetica, sans-serif;

}

.text {
font-size: 13px;
color: #CC6600;
font-style: normal;
font-weight: normal;
font-family: Verdana, Helvetica, sans-serif;
}

A:link {
color: #993300;
font-style: normal;
font-weight: normal;
font-size: 12px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}


A:visited {
color: #663300;
font-style: normal;
font-weight: normal;
font-size: 12px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A:active {
color: #993300;
font-style: normal;
font-weight: normal;
font-size: 12px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A:hover {
color: #CC6600;
font-style: normal;
font-size: 12px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: underline;
background-color: transparent;
}

A.footer:link {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 9px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}


A.footer:visited {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 9px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A.footer:active {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 9px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A.footer:hover {
color: #CC6600;
font-style: normal;
font-size: 9px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: underline;
background-color: transparent;
}


A.footer2:link {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 10px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}


A.footer2:visited {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 10px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A.footer2:active {
color: #CC6600;
font-style: normal;
font-weight: normal;
font-size: 10px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: none;
background-color: transparent;
}

A.footer2:hover {
color: #CC6600;
font-style: normal;
font-size: 10px;
font-family: Verdana, Helvetica, sans-serif;
text-decoration: underline;
background-color: transparent;
}


.cornered{
/*border-bottom:thin #FFFFFF solid;*/
/*border-right:thin solid #FFFFFF;*/
}

.premium_error_message {display: none;}
  .more_sell_products {display: none;}
  .online_payment_error_message {display: none;}
  .online_payment_info {display: none;}
  .cms_error_message {display: none;}
  .8_12_pages_error_message {display: none;}
  .30_pages_error_message {display: none;}
  .20_30_pages_error_message {display: none;}
  .13_19_pages_error_message {display: none;}
  
#menuContainer div {
	cursor: pointer !important;
}